AutoFillをサポートする優れたサードパーティのグリッドコントロールを知っている人は誰でもいます(Excelのように)。また、Excelへの適切なエクスポートとExcelからのインポート(貼り付け)も便利です。私は主にこれを実行できるWinFormsグリッドに興味がありますが、AutoFill機能を備えたSilverlightグリッドまたはActiveXグリッドがあるかどうかにも興味があります。
2 に答える
SpreadsheetGear for .NETは、ASP.NET アプリケーションでも使用できる WinForms 用の Excel 互換スプレッドシート コントロールです。Excel と互換性のあるオートフィル (API と同様にマウスによるドラッグ フィル) と、線形および成長トレンド、日付/時刻などを含むより複雑なケースを処理する Data Series コマンド / UI / API をサポートしています。
SpreadsheetGear は、xls および xlsx からの読み取り、書き込み、および Windows クリップボード上の Excel コンテンツを処理できるクリップボード サポート (切り取り、コピー、貼り付け) もサポートしています。
Silverlight コントロール用の SpreadsheetGear はまだありませんが、これは将来の優先事項です。
試してみたい場合は、こちらから無料試用版をダウンロードできます。
免責事項: 私は SpreadsheetGear LLC を所有しています
「Excel へのエクスポートと Excel からのインポート (貼り付け)」を提供する場合、それは、ユーザーのマシンに Excel が確実にインストールされている環境に配布することを意味しますか? もしそうなら、VSTOプロジェクトを介して、またはおそらくExcelシートをWinFormのコントロールとして埋め込むことによって、Excel自体を必要なグリッドとして使用することを検討できますか? 後者の場合、いくつかの相互運用のフープを飛び越える必要があるかもしれませんが、それでも可能だと思います。
明らかに、すべてのユーザーがマシンに Excel をインストールすることが保証されていない場合は、私の回答を無視してかまいません ;-)